2023 Supreme(Pat) 1097

CHAKRADHARI SHARAN SINGH, BIBEK CHAUDHURI
Shrikant Mandal @ Shrikant Kumar Mandal – Appellant
Versus
State of Bihar – Respondent


Advocates appeared:
For the Appellant : Mr. Ajay Mukherjee.
For the Respondent: Ms. Shashi Bala Verma, APP.

Chakradhari Sharan Singh, J.—This appeal has been preferred by the appellant under Section 374(2) of the Code of Criminal Procedure, putting to challenge a judgment of conviction dated dated 27.10.2021 and an order of sentence dated 29.10.2021, passed by learned 6th Additional Sessions Judge-cum-Special Judge (POCSO), Banka in G.R. No. 168 of 2019, arising out of Mahila (Banka) P.S. Case No. 60 of 2019, whereby the appellant has been convicted and sentenced as under:—

Appellant

Penal Provision

Imprisonment

Sentence Fine (Rs.)

In default of fine

Shrikant

376D of the IPC

R.I. for 20 years

20,000/-

R.I. for six months

Mandal

4 of the POCSO Act

RI for 10 years

10,000/-

RI for three months

2. Two persons including this appellant were made accused in Mahila (Banka) P.S. Case No. 60 of 2019, instituted on the basis of the written report of the victim. The case of coaccused Sohan Kumar was, however, referred to Juvenile Justice Board in the light of the prosecution's case itself that he was below 18 years of age as on the date of occurrence.
